Font Size: a A A

Incoherent Ontology Debugging Based On Forgetting Strategy

Posted on:2019-08-27Degree:MasterType:Thesis
Country:ChinaCandidate:K L SunFull Text:PDF
GTID:2428330548994337Subject:Engineering
Abstract/Summary:PDF Full Text Request
Due to the different understandings of the domain knowledge,ontology developers often define some logical erroneous concepts during the process of ontology construction,ontology merging and ontology evolution.These erroneous concepts are called unsatisfiable concepts and cause the ontology to be incoherent.Ontology debugging is the main method for solving the incoherent problem.The goal is calculating the minimal unsatisfiable preserving sub-TBox(MUPS)of an unsatisfiable concept,which is the key reason of the unsatisfiability of the concept.The black-box algorithm based on "expansion-contraction" framework has become the major method for ontology debugging because of its portability and robustness.However,the black-box calls external reasoners for the satisfiability checking in the expansion stage.The checking results determine whether an axiom is inserted in the axiom set relevant to the unsatisfiable concepts.Similarly,in the contraction stage,the reasoners are also called to check the satisfiability of the axiom set.Therefore,the frequently calling leads to the inefficiency of the black-box debugging method.To solve the problem mentioned above,this study presents an optimization method based on the Forgetting strategy to reduce the size of input axioms.The proposed method can reduce the entire ontology to small sub-ontology,and perform the black-box debugging method based on the small sub-ontology to reduce the number of satisfiability checking both in the expansion stage and in the contraction stage.To achieve the above goal,this study creates forgetting rules based on the resolution method.The forgetting operations focus on the concepts and roles suitable for the Forgetting rules.Then labels are created for the forgotten concepts and roles for tracing the forgetting operations.Next,calculate the MUPS based on the candidate axiom set after forgetting operation.If axioms in the MUPS do not belong to the original ontology,then the created labels are used to restore these axioms.Then,a minimality operation is also performed for the restored set of axioms.We have also proved the availability and correctness of forgetting strategy and verified its validity in the experiments.
Keywords/Search Tags:Ontology debugging, Incoherent ontology, Black-box debugging method, Forgetting strategy
PDF Full Text Request
Related items